在el-table中,操作按钮中el-button 按钮置灰的操作,disable 不生效 是加了v-if判断,解决方法是 添加 key="1" 1 2 3 4 5 6 7 8 9 10 11 12 13 14 <el-table-column fixed="right"align="center"label="操作"> <template slot-scope="scope"> <el-button type="primary" v-if="scope.row.ta...
一旦定义了v-disable指令,我们就可以在任何组件中通过该指令来控制el-button的禁用状态了。这只需要在模板中的el-button标签上添加我们自定义的v-disable指令即可。 <template> <el-button v-disable="isDisabled">点击我</el-button> </template> <script> export default { data() { return { isDisabled: t...
你可以通过触发toggleDisable方法或fetchDataAndSetDisableStatus方法(或任何其他改变isDisabled值的方法)来观察按钮disabled状态的变化。 html <template> <el-button :disabled="isDisabled">点击我</el-button> <el-button @click="toggleDisable">切换禁用状态</el-button> ...
<button @click="toggleButtonState">Toggle Button State</button> </div> </template> <script> export default { data() { return { isButtonDisabled: false }; }, methods: { toggleButtonState() { this.isButtonDisabled = !this.isButtonDisabled; } }, directives: { disableButton: { update(el,...
'el-button--' + type : '', buttonSize ? 'el-button--' + buttonSize : '', { 'is-disabled': buttonDisabled, 'is-loading': loading, 'is-plain': plain, 'is-round': round, 'is-circle': circle } ]" 拿element的btn源码来举例子就是在class里面判断是否disable来加一个类is-disabled。
'el-button--' + buttonSize : '', { 'is-disabled': buttonDisabled, 'is-loading': loading, 'is-plain': plain, 'is-round': round, 'is-circle': circle } ]" 拿element的btn源码来举例子就是在class里面判断是否disable来加一个类is-disabled。 有用 回复 ...
vue 中button 标签样式和功能禁⽤的写法 ⽬录 button 标签样式和功能禁⽤ 1.不选中情况下 2.选中情况下 3.代码 vue el-button 样式⾃定义⽤按钮切换界⾯ button 标签样式和功能禁⽤ 需求:常⽤的表格编辑功能,都是只有选中某⾏数据才能显⽰样式编辑和内容编辑,不选中为灰度且不能编辑(次编辑...
</el-card> 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. 14. 2.2 脚本script data: 这里表格绑定的数据对象tableData是写死的,实际可以根据需求从后端获取。 这里声明了currentRowObj,用于保存选中的行内容。 这里声明了disableLockReleaseButton,用于控制按钮是否可用。
el.disabled =false }) }) } }) } exportdefaultbtnControl 需要注意的是这里把按钮原来的点击事件直接换成指令即可,就是说原来的@click直接去掉换成v-btn-control指令 1 2 3 <el-button v-btn-control="create">新建 </el-button> 注意,create方法是要有返回值的,并且需要是一个promise ...
需求来源于一个管理系统的权限管控模块。 需求描述:进入页面,触发方法,从服务端获取当前用户在当前页面下的操作权限,生成对应的操作按钮。正常情况,接到这种需求,都会想到使用子组件获取操作权限,v-for 遍历生成按钮,父组件调用,如下:子组件 mybutton.vue<template> <div> <el-button v-for="item in but ...